While looking through Historical Aerials it looks like the SP did not have a heavy shop in West Colton. The UP built it and the transfer table in the early 2000's. The two tank farm tracks weren't there either. The SP did have quite a car shop set up, but I don't have space for that. Maybe I can spread the light service and ready tracks out and move Riverside Ave to the disappearing backdrop/mirror and end the yard scene there. Pepper Ave would be deleted.
Removing this area from my plan sure would simplify the area and give a bit more wriggle room. The heavy service would be rarely used operationally anyway, where as the light service and ready tracks would be in constant rotation. The more I think it through the more it makes sense. I already have the A/D tracks and related train order building mixed into the scene.
